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
470651341 18946313 718879
22415144 173444950 2811047823
22415144 173444950 2811047823
46 27 423021
All about undefined
Interested in learning more?
22415144 173444950 2811047823
46 27 423021
See more
5309408 00726 820960
0827818 05576653051 815462731 68817921
See more
922183 59155083647 47642922696
98574930 1300225848 497422398
See more